// Client setup for the Spoolhaven printer-spooler microservice.
// Support team: this client retries failed spool jobs three times
// with exponential backoff before routing them to the dead-letter
// tray. Timeouts are fixed at 15 seconds and should not be changed
// without a ticket. The client authenticates against the internal
// spool gateway using the key that follows:

service key, fawip-bajef: kto11_Qt5wZK9vdNC

**Ticket VK-2291: Sweeper misconfigured in staging**

The Dustpan retention sweeper on staging is deleting records at 7 days instead of 90. Env drift: staging copied the demo profile. Fix `DUSTPAN_RETENTION_DAYS=90` and restart the worker. The sweeper also lost its credential during the copy, so re-add the line below in the staging env file.

secret setting of yafof-tawep: RELAY_SECRET8=8abb5772

Subject: Handover — Markpress pipeline

Hi Dorla,

Taking over release duties for the Markpress markdown rendering pipeline as of this sprint. The renderer builds are reproducible now; the sanitizer stage was moved ahead of the syntax-highlight pass to fix the nested-fence escaping bug. CI publishes to the internal Quillgate registry, and the deploy job verifies every artifact before promotion. Review the staging diff before Thursday's cut. The verification step expects the key below, so keep it in sync with the pipeline config.

deploy key for kahof-tadup: bky4_rRMZ